Kenji Machida
Kenji Machida was a judge for the Superior Court of Los Angeles County in California. He was appointed by former governor Gray Davis in 2001.[1] Machida retired in 2018.
Elections
2014
See also: California judicial elections, 2014
Machida ran for re-election to the Los Angeles County Superior Court.
As an unopposed incumbent, he was automatically re-elected without appearing on the ballot.

Education
Machida received a J.D. from Harvard University.[3]
